English Origin

Pride

A modern virtue name celebrating dignity, self-respect, and appropriate confidence as character ideals. Pride has evolved from its association with the vice (in religious contexts) to a celebratory name reflecting contemporary values of self-affirmation and authenticity. The name is bold, assertive, and increasingly chosen by parents valuing empowerment and self-worth.
